Bostons International ambassadors of garage rock 'n' roll have once again teamed up with JIM DIAMOND (White Stripes) and KIM FOWLEY for an explosive 12-song scorcher of an album. FOWLEY describes the band as a cross between the 1964 BEATLES and the 1977 RAMONES. On "DIAL M.", they expand these influences to include hints of '60s BUBBLEGUM, '70s POWER-POP and even a LITTLE BIT O' SOUL!
